Subject: [RFC 04/12] PCI: Convert arch/powerpc to pci_is_sriov_* helpers
Date: Thu,  4 Jun 2026 08:01:45 -0700	[thread overview]
Message-ID: <20260604150153.3619662-5-dimitri.daskalakis1@gmail.com> (raw)
In-Reply-To: <20260604150153.3619662-1-dimitri.daskalakis1@gmail.com>

From: Dimitri Daskalakis <daskald@meta.com>

Convert SR-IOV-specific is_physfn / is_virtfn reads in the PowerPC
PCI code to use pci_is_sriov_physfn() / pci_is_sriov_virtfn(). These
call sites are all SR-IOV-specific: they guard SR-IOV state
dereferences, VF PE management, or sit inside #ifdef CONFIG_PCI_IOV
blocks. Converting them keeps SR-IOV semantics intact once is_physfn
and is_virtfn widen to cover any virtualization type.

Files touched:
  arch/powerpc/kernel/pci_dn.c
  arch/powerpc/platforms/powernv/pci-ioda.c
  arch/powerpc/platforms/powernv/pci-sriov.c
  arch/powerpc/platforms/pseries/eeh_pseries.c
  arch/powerpc/platforms/pseries/setup.c

No functional changes.
